My vue project stops working when I try to npm install any new package. I was installing axios.
First I got,
npm install npm WARN [email protected] requires a peer of ajv@^6.0.0 but none is installed. You must install peer dependencies yourself. npm WARN [email protected] requires a peer of webpack@^4.0.0 but none is installed. You must install peer dependencies yourself. npm WARN [email protected] requires a peer of webpack@^4.0.0 but none is installed. You must install peer dependencies yourself. npm WARN [email protected] requires a peer of webpack@^4.0.0 but none is installed. You must install peer dependencies yourself.
so I install those packages,
npm install [email protected] ajv@^6.0.0 [email protected] webpack@^4.0.0 [email protected] webpack@^4.0.0 [email protected] webpack@^4.0.0
Then I get these warnings,
npm WARN [email protected] requires a peer of webpack@^3.1.0 but none is installed. You must install peer dependencies yourself. npm WARN [email protected] requires a peer of webpack@1 || ^2 || ^2.1.0-beta || ^2.2.0-rc || ^3 but none is installed. You must install peer dependencies yourself.
which tell me to use webpack 3
So I ran,
npm install webpack@^3.1.0 [email protected] [email protected]
Which then gives me the following warning, telling to use webpack4.
npm WARN [email protected] requires a peer of webpack@^4.0.0 but none is installed. You must install peer dependencies yourself. npm WARN [email protected] requires a peer of webpack@^4.0.0 but none is installed. You must install peer dependencies yourself. npm WARN [email protected] requires a peer of webpack@^4.0.0 but none is installed. You must install peer dependencies yourself.
How can I solve this problem?
